Other mistake: Captain Eureka losing his finger makes absolutely no sense. He doesn't cry out in pain, there's no blood, and where the finger ended up is completely illogical. The finger didn't just sever on its own; it's shown that severing only occurs when passing through objects. Captain Eureka goes through a wall that is a good fifteen feet away from where the finger is discovered, and it is implausible to think it could have rolled there on its own.

Trivia: When Allison and Jack are talking about their relationship and marriage is mentioned, Allison says "is it so inconceivable?" This episode features Wallace Shawn (as Dr. Hughes). Shawn starred in "The Princess Bride" where his character was known for saying "inconceivable."
